Today I started my Cat Live rotation with Cardio Core Circuit #144. Now I had a bit of dread since I find the Cardio Core Circuit DVD to be very, very hard, but I said I would give it the ol' Watulan try. I really, really, REALLY enjoyed it!! It was quite challenging but not puke-in-a-bucket hard, and had a nice mix of exercises. There were 5 rounds of 3 cardio exercises repeated once and a core exercise done one time. The cardio rounds used the loop and stability ball on several exercises, but except for the last round it would be very easy to sub a plain ol' playground ball for the stability ball. The core segments used the gliding disks. Anyhoo this is probably more than anyone wanted to know about this workout, but it is high on my list of favorite Lives at this point.
